Address

VfpUBcPRwW3bjv4y7MKRrjsSzz3k9eLEk5

0 VIA

Confirmed
Total Received277.56929436 VIA140588.85 IDR
Total Sent277.56929436 VIA140588.85 IDR
Final Balance0 VIA0.00 IDR
No. Transactions2

Transactions

VfpUBcPRwW3bjv4y7MKRrjsSzz3k9eLEk5277.56929436 VIA28116.15 IDR140588.85 IDR
 
VnLP4CHsTG7CZEtZRbvLWw6QzpWuUn16Qm257.42296560 VIA26075.45 IDR130384.73 IDR
Vb9JcFZLZXHsDQEAJM3o4aH4QKpdVR1wRi20.04632877 VIA2030.58 IDR10153.47 IDR×
VipcBgrGZqBJL5KN1wL8pn3U5asnEsnroi307.09950056 VIA31107.39 IDR155545.90 IDR
 
Vb5d16Q7LZVL8WkP48jzrhsVSJxRrnyKoV4.13157538 VIA418.50 IDR2092.64 IDR
VfpUBcPRwW3bjv4y7MKRrjsSzz3k9eLEk5277.56929436 VIA28116.15 IDR140588.85 IDR
VeE6X3skDSf45UMHQ7fb6P55kgRZYqvEXb5.24823612 VIA531.62 IDR2658.23 IDR
VaJKN2nXkAggW46t3FSvXEvWfs82V1Y2Rb20.05039470 VIA2030.99 IDR10155.52 IDR